Owen Farrell hits back at Matt O'Connor criticism

England fly-half Owen Farrell defends England after Leicester head coach Matt O'Connor's criticism of Stuart Lancaster.

England and Saracens fly-half Owen Farrell has refuted Leicester coach Matt O'Connor's comments that the national side are too negative on the field.

The Tigers head coach criticised interim boss Stuart Lancaster for dropping Leicester duo Toby Flood and Ben Youngs as well as claiming that England don't enter a game trying to win.

"He is entitled to his own opinion," Farrell told the Northern Echo. "We have our own views. We are excited about the way we are playing at the minute. The way we played against Wales was a massive step in the right direction for us and we all thought that.

"It was still disappointing to lose a game when we created quite a few chances but we are massively excited about the way we are going and I hope we can build on that.

"I don't see how else you go into a rugby game [but trying to win it]. I don't think I have ever had a mindset to just avoid defeat otherwise you don't play how you want to do."

England take on France in their next Six Nations clash this weekend.
